The novel, Once A Man Twice A Child, is a very unique perspective of Lennon's life and death. One which is substantiated by the accumulation of some very intriguing facts. Facts which are all related to his untimely demise on December 8, l980, yet precede his murder by up to 13 Years.

Once A Man Twice A Child - Part I Tomorrow Never Knows, is a fast paced thriller written in the mystical tradition of both "Alice In Wonderland" and "The Celestine Prophecy."

It is based on over 20 years of research into ancient and current world events, Beatle history, and true-life experiences of the author. Dan Alice shows how an explicit prophecy of John Lennon's death began unfolding on December 8th, 1967.

The novel begins with a grown man pondering how to write a documentary about the frightening information he has researched in connection to the foreshadowing of John Lennon's death. Eventually he changes his mind and decides it would be better to write a factual related parable to expose his confessions and childhood experiences.

The tale sends a child named Alice on a journey of self-discovery. On his adventure little Alice makes leaps in consciousness and awareness, yet he grows intensely confused about why facts, strange synchronicities and spiritual insights were sequentially revealed to his trusting eyes.

His journey begins after experiencing bizarre coincidences, disturbing dreams, and spiritual visions which traumatize him at an early age. These events all begin with a connection to a single song entitled "I Am The Walrus," released by The Beatles on December 8th, 1967 as part of a strange double EP record package entitled "Magical Mystery Tour."

This song and the subsequent prophecies revealed to the child come into being exactly 13 years to the day before the murder of one John Ono Lennon. Delving deeply into the lyrics, album covers, and inspiration for the Magical Mystery Tour project Alice uncovers a plethora of hidden messages and accurate predictions.
